NZ Women’s Health Research Review Issue 50

NZ Women’s Health Research Review Issue 50

In this issue:
– Ulipristal acetate emergency contraception in Canada
– Lidocaine 1% paracervical block for IUD insertion
– Oral contraceptives and mortality
– OTC birth control pill and contraceptive autonomy
– The effects of sleep disturbance on quality of life in postmenopausal women
– Health outcomes of MHT initiated or continued after age 65
– MHT and all-cause mortality
– LNG-IUS vs hysteroscopic niche resection
– Predictors of endometrial ablation failure
– Prednisolone for pelvic pain in women with deep infiltrative endometriosis

Dr Beth Messenger

Beth trained at Guys and St Thomas’ in London, graduating in 2000. She moved to New Zealand in 2004 and has been working in sexual and reproductive health for almost 20 years. Dr Maritza Farrant

MBChB, MPH, FRACP Maritza is a general and reproductive endocrinologist at Te Toka Tumai, Te Whatu Ora. After completion of advanced training, Maritza worked at the University of Washington (UW) in the area of male reproductive endocrinology and coauthored publications in hormonal male contraception. Dr Jessica Dunning

Jessica is a NZ trained gynaecologist. She works as a senior medical officer at Te Toka Tumai Auckland Hospital and at Auckland Gynaecology Group. She completed a minimal access surgery fellowship in 2024. Her clinical interests are in the diagnosis and treatment of endometriosis, abnormal uterine bleeding and fibroids.
